Output 33c914a96d0698b8a08ab492a8b4f84dc54c593391329e94fc851b7bfb28c44e:0

value
14344869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9c8af0973f0196fc02f6a05312e48fb5ae8444f OP_EQUALVERIFY OP_CHECKSIG
address
1LrY3Nuos6DFRHGNTf1RDMjShoZjhFTcV9
transaction
33c914a96d0698b8a08ab492a8b4f84dc54c593391329e94fc851b7bfb28c44e
confirmations
521330
spent
true